您好,登錄后才能下訂單哦!
Mac系統下 PHP7安裝Swoole擴展 教程
今天我用的PHP版本是:PHP7.3.5
Swoole下載地址:http://pecl.php.net/package/swoole
下載后,
tar -xzf swoole-4.4.0.tgz
cd swoole-4.4.0
phpize
./configure
make
make test
make install
解釋:
phpize是用來擴展php擴展模塊的
通過phpize可以建立php的外掛模塊。
./configure 是源代碼安裝的第一步,作用對即將安裝的軟件進行配置,檢查當前的環境是否滿足安裝軟件的依賴關系。
make編譯
make test 對編譯結果進行測試
make install 進行安裝
最后呈現:
macdeMacBook-Pro:swoole-4.4.0 mac$ make install
Installing shared extensions: /usr/local/Cellar/php/7.3.5/pecl/20180731/
Installing header files: /usr/local/Cellar/php/7.3.5/include/php/
2、修改php.ini加入:
放在最后即可:
extension=swoole.so
解釋:php.ini在哪里呢?
看phpinfo() 中顯示的。
Loaded Configuration File /usr/local/etc/php/7.3/php.ini
然后查看有沒有安裝成功呢?
php -m
里面已經有swoole了。
但這時, phpinfo()還沒有swoole
3.重啟服務器
sudo apachectl restart
再查看phpinfo()
就有大大字的swoole了!
如果你的mac,在安裝過程中報錯,請根據報錯情況來解決。
基本是這樣安裝的。
歡迎加QQ群,PHP技術問答群, 群號:292626152 和大家討論。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。